So hi everyone, my name's Charlie (or Chaz, if you prefer) - a brilliant androgynous name that I'm proud to have had since birth. I'm 17 (near enough anyway) and live in England where I study maths, physics and geography and work part-time at a gross fast food place.

As for why I'm here, I've never felt like I fitted in with one gender. I don't feel entirely male or entirely female, but more like some of each, which I'm guessing means you could consider me somewhat androgynous. People know me for being somewhat 'boyish' and a lot of people know that I like girls, but don't know about my gender issues. I went through a horribly depressive phase a few years ago because I was so confused about who I was (male or female) and because I felt so uncomfortable with my 'developing' body. I've gotten used to it now, but I'll never be totally ok with having a female body, but I don't think I'd love to have a male body that much either. Now, I try as much as I can to make myself appear gender-neutral, which is Gosh darned near impossible with a girly-looking face, but I like to try. Part of what I did involved losing a ton of weight so I have an almost-flat chest, which I'm so happy with myself for doing and I think I could live in this body reasonably comfortably.

Anyway, that's me. I don't have a lot to say really - I'm young. But hi everyone, you all seem like friendly people here!
